ISIS Recruits over 400 Children as 'Cubs of the Caliphate,' Training Includes Beheading
The Islamic State has grown its ranks by an estimated 400 children who were recruited by the terrorist organization in combat, espionage, and propaganda roles as part of its "Cubs of the Caliphate" initiative. While some of the children are recruited with their parents' consent as part of a "military training exercise," several more have been kidnapped without their parents knowing. The children are taught to handle and fire live ammunition, how to drive, and even how to behead.
